Product description
Its slim construction is especially well suited to hallways, bedrooms, or dressing areas without visually weighing down the space. Three elegantly arranged wooden elements create practical hanging options, while the integrated round shelf provides space for keys, a wallet, or small bags. That way, everything important for leaving the house stays close at hand.
RAKKU was designed by Kazushige Miyake, who reinterprets functional everyday objects with a calm, Japanese-inspired aesthetic. The combination of reduced geometry, natural oak, and subtle metal accents makes this coat rack a discreet design statement.
In the Oak finish, RAKKU blends harmoniously into both modern and classic interiors and adds to the series with a piece of furniture that combines order, lightness, and timeless elegance.
Designer: Kazushige Miyake
About
Japanese designer Kazushige Miyake (b. 1973) graduated from Tama Art University in Tokyo with a specialization in design. He then began his career as a product designer in Great Britain before returning to Japan in 1999.
In 2005, he founded his own design studio. Today, Miyake Design is synonymous with clear and functional product design, from lounge chairs to suitcases, always with the discerning consumer in mind. Miyake favors simplicity and straightforwardness in his designs, and believes that every object has its own form.
This form is not limited to its physical presence, but also includes the aura or atmosphere that surrounds the object and its effect on those who use it.
Kazushige Miyake has received a number of prestigious design awards, including the iF Design Award, the Red Dot Design Award and the Good Design Award. Today, he is a member of the evaluation committees for both the Good Design Award and the iF Design Award.
